          It works very similarly to Stryd so yes, power walking is recorded. Values for endurance running and power hiking on Pro match Stryd well for me. We are still working on wrist power so likely to be even better when release firmware is available. I have not used my Stryd much until this testing and I find I use wrist power much more than I did the Stryd because of being another gadget, battery life, water ingress, etc. of Stryd

          Yes, I would get rid of it, when It rains it is completely useless.

                                      @trailcafe not at the moment, no, but for this special case you can pair Stryd natively and still have it.
                                      It is becoming ever more important to have more than 1 S+ app/guide enabled, or at least one app and one guide. I know it’s not that easy, and not just for resources, there are cases where specific S+ combinations would be conflicting, such as apps and guides all creating laps and interfering with each other, but these are corner cases, and I hope after the launch of the S+ store Suunto will work on having two or more S+ running.
